I signed ds (9) up for a summer book club and I'm kind of excited about it. I really think this will give him a strong start going into 4th grade next year. There will be two groups - one for boys and one for girls. We'll meet at the library on Saturday mornings. Each week the kids choose a different book from the Bluebonnet book list. The library has them all, so hopefully we won't have to buy anything. Then they fill out a Book report which has things like list the main characters, describe the setting in two sentences, and write a five sentence summary of the story. Then they get together and talk about the book they read. Each child reads a different book, so they'll all have something different to talk about. I think there are incentives along the way like McDonalds gift certificates and stuff. I hope it works!

MM! It sounds like a wonderful idea. We use the incentive "Child's name Day" ie. ~Mark's Day~ tohelp the boys meet the challange to read 30 books in thirty days. When you meet the challange you get to be "in charge" of the family activities for a day. The boys love it and so do we. ßß!
